Memorix is an engaging and fast-paced memory matching game designed for puzzle enthusiasts of all ages. It challenges players to memorize a grid of colorful blocks that briefly flash, then flip face-down, requiring quick thinking and sharp memory to match pairs before time runs out. The game incorporates dynamic mechanics such as chain combos, score multipliers, and time bonuses, making each session increasingly exciting and strategic. Its simple yet addictive gameplay is perfect for quick breaks or dedicated gaming sessions, and the global leaderboard fosters a competitive spirit. Available for free on both iOS and Android, Memorix combines intuitive controls with a sleek interface, making it accessible for casual gamers and puzzle aficionados alike. The game’s emphasis on memorization, speed, and strategic chaining distinguishes it from typical memory games, offering a fresh take on a classic concept.

Chronicle 2.0 is an innovative AI-powered presentation design tool tailored for professionals, educators, and entrepreneurs who need visually compelling slides quickly and efficiently. By transforming notes, prompts, or existing decks into polished, on-brand presentations, Chronicle streamlines the often time-consuming process of slide creation. Its intelligent system asks simple questions to generate a strong first draft, which users can then refine through an intuitive conversational interface, ensuring the final product aligns perfectly with their vision. What sets Chronicle apart is its focus on quality and on-brand consistency, avoiding the typical 'AI slop' seen in less refined tools. This makes it ideal for users seeking both speed and professionalism in their presentation workflows.
